The Importance of Groundwater in Agriculture

The atmospheric burden of greenhouse gases is so great that there is no known countervailing force that will reverse the loss of the snowpack. If heat waves persist across consecutive years then pressure on groundwater increases. Counterintuitively when we see years of drought we also see increased risk of dangerous flooding from increased atmospheric moisture. As Francesco says this creates an urgent need for rethinking how we capture and store water.
